- PROCESSES FOR THE PREPARATION OF HIGHLY PURE PRUCALOPRIDE SUCCINATE AND ITS INTERMEDIATES
-
Provided herein are purification processes for the preparation of highly pure prucalopride succinate salt. Provided also herein are improved, commercially viable and industrially advantageous processes for the preparation of Prucalopride and its intermediate compounds, for example, methyl 4-acetylamino-5-chloro-2,3-dihydrobenzo[b]furan-7-carboxylate and alkyl 4-[[(4-amino-5-chloro-2,3-dihydro-7-benzofuranyl)carbonyl]-amino]-1-piperidinecarboxylate.
